If you’ve tried to quit smoking with willpower and failed, the problem isn’t you—it’s the method. Hypnosis speaks to the part of you that makes the choice.

In this empowering episode, Dr. Gary Danko shares how people can finally break free from nicotine addiction using the transformative power of hypnosis. With over 30 years of experience helping hundreds of clients successfully quit, Dr. Danko explains why quitting smoking with hypnosis is one of the most effective and lasting solutions available—especially when willpower, patches, or medication have failed.

Unlike conscious efforts that rely on discipline and short-term motivation, hypnosis works by addressing the subconscious programming that fuels the smoking habit. Dr. Danko walks you through how the brain becomes conditioned to associate cigarettes with stress relief, comfort, or identity—and how hypnosis can gently rewire those associations at the root.

You’ll learn:

  • Why smoking is a subconscious pattern, not just a physical addiction
  • How triggers like stress, boredom, and emotion feed the habit
  • What happens during a hypnosis session to break the smoking loop
  • How the subconscious mind responds to guided suggestion and imagery
  • What sets hypnosis apart from other quit-smoking methods

You’ll also hear inspiring examples of clients who quit smoking through hypnosis after decades of addiction—some even after just one or two sessions. Dr. Danko’s approach is not about shame or control, but about liberation—replacing the smoking habit with a deep sense of calm, clarity, and self-trust.

The heart was always off-limits to surgeons. Cutting into it spelled instant death for the patient. That is, until a ragtag group of doctors scattered across the Midwest and Texas decided to throw out the rule book. Working in makeshift laboratories and home garages, using medical devices made from scavenged machine parts and beer tubes, these men and women invented the field of open heart surgery. Odds are, someone you know is alive because of them. So why has history left them behind? Presented by Chris Pine, CARDIAC COWBOYS tells the gripping true story behind the birth of heart surgery, and the young, Greatest Generation doctors who made it happen. For years, they competed and feuded, racing to be the first, the best, and the most prolific. Some appeared on the cover of Time Magazine, operated on kings and advised presidents. Others ended up disgraced, penniless, and convicted of felonies. Together, they ignited a revolution in medicine, and changed the world.
